Add 56/27 and 14/56
1st number: 2 2/27, 2nd number: 14/56
56/27 + 14/56 is 251/108.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 27 and 56 is 1512
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1512 - For the 1st fraction, since 27 × 56 = 1512,
56/27 = 56 × 56/27 × 56 = 3136/1512 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 56 × 27 = 1512,
14/56 = 14 × 27/56 × 27 = 378/1512 - Add the two like fractions:
3136/1512 + 378/1512 = 3136 + 378/1512 = 3514/1512 - 3514/1512 simplified gives 251/108
- So, 56/27 + 14/56 = 251/108
